2026 Best Value Educational, Instructional, & Curriculum Supervision Schools in the United States
If you want to know which schools deliver the best value for the educational, instructional, & curriculum supervision degrees they offer, see the list below.
Best Value Educational, Instructional, & Curriculum Supervision Schools
University Of Illinois At Chicago earned the #1 spot for value among educational, instructional, & curriculum supervision schools in the United States. Located in the city of Chicago, University Of Illinois At Chicago is a very large public university. The average in-state cost of tuition and fees is $15,949, with out-of-state students paying around $32,009. Educational, Instructional, & Curriculum Supervision graduates carry a median of $20,115 in student loans. Soon after graduation, educational, instructional, & curriculum supervision degree recipients from University Of Illinois At Chicago generally make around $61,834. That is a strong return on a $20,115 median debt. University Of Illinois At Chicago admits about 77% of applicants.
Cuny Queens College is a great value for students pursuing a degree in educational, instructional, & curriculum supervision, landing the #2 spot this year. Located in the city of Queens, Cuny Queens College is a very large public university. Students from in state pay about $7,538 in tuition and fees, with out-of-state students paying around $15,488. Typical student debt for educational, instructional, & curriculum supervision graduates is $12,157. Educational, Instructional, & Curriculum Supervision graduates of Cuny Queens College earn a median of $41,847 early in their careers. Weighed against typical debt, the earnings make a compelling case for value. The acceptance rate is 64%.
The strong cost-to-outcome balance at The University Of Texas Pan American earned it the #3 place for educational, instructional, & curriculum supervision. Set in the city of Edinburg, The University Of Texas Pan American is a very large public institution. The average in-state cost of tuition and fees is $9,799, while out-of-state students pay about $19,645. Educational, Instructional, & Curriculum Supervision graduates carry a median of $14,694 in student loans. Educational, Instructional, & Curriculum Supervision graduates of The University Of Texas Pan American earn a median of $61,569 early in their careers. Set against $14,694 in median debt, that is a healthy payoff. The acceptance rate is 94%.
A rank of #4 makes Worcester State University one of the best values for educational, instructional, & curriculum supervision. Set in the city of Worcester, Worcester State University is a moderately-sized public institution. The average in-state cost of tuition and fees is $11,786, with out-of-state students paying around $17,866. Students borrow a median of $24,451 to complete the educational, instructional, & curriculum supervision program here. Soon after graduation, educational, instructional, & curriculum supervision degree recipients from Worcester State University generally make around $45,297. Weighed against typical debt, the earnings make a compelling case for value. The acceptance rate is 88%.
University Of Wisconsin River Falls is a great value for students pursuing a degree in educational, instructional, & curriculum supervision, landing the #5 spot this year. Located in the town of River Falls, University Of Wisconsin River Falls is a moderately-sized public university. Students from in state pay about $9,008 in tuition and fees, while out-of-state students pay about $17,470. Typical student debt for educational, instructional, & curriculum supervision graduates is $24,245. Educational, Instructional, & Curriculum Supervision graduates of University Of Wisconsin River Falls earn a median of $47,577 early in their careers. Set against $24,245 in median debt, that is a healthy payoff. University Of Wisconsin River Falls admits about 82% of applicants.

Western Carolina University earned the #6 position for value in educational, instructional, & curriculum supervision this year. Western Carolina University is a large public school located in the town of Cullowhee. Expect in-state tuition and fees of around $4,630, with out-of-state students paying around $8,630. Typical student debt for educational, instructional, & curriculum supervision graduates is $24,174. Early-career educational, instructional, & curriculum supervision graduates make about $66,432. That is a strong return on a $24,174 median debt. Western Carolina University admits about 82% of applicants.
University Of Illinois At Springfield came in at #7 for value in educational, instructional, & curriculum supervision this year. University Of Illinois At Springfield is a moderately-sized public school located in the city of Springfield. The average in-state cost of tuition and fees is $12,557, with out-of-state students paying around $20,139. Typical student debt for educational, instructional, & curriculum supervision graduates is $24,925. Soon after graduation, educational, instructional, & curriculum supervision degree recipients from University Of Illinois At Springfield generally make around $60,442. Weighed against typical debt, the earnings make a compelling case for value. University Of Illinois At Springfield admits about 86% of applicants.
Granite State College landed the #8 spot for educational, instructional, & curriculum supervision value this year. Located in the city of Manchester, Granite State College is a mid-sized public university. The average in-state cost of tuition and fees is $7,724, with out-of-state students paying around $9,284. Students borrow a median of $27,522 to complete the educational, instructional, & curriculum supervision program here. Educational, Instructional, & Curriculum Supervision graduates of Granite State College earn a median of $55,121 early in their careers. Weighed against typical debt, the earnings make a compelling case for value.
Western Kentucky University ranked #9 on our 2026 list of the best value educational, instructional, & curriculum supervision schools. Located in the city of Bowling Green, Western Kentucky University is a large public university. Students from in state pay about $11,652 in tuition and fees, compared with $27,000 for out-of-state students. Students borrow a median of $24,499 to complete the educational, instructional, & curriculum supervision program here. Soon after graduation, educational, instructional, & curriculum supervision degree recipients from Western Kentucky University generally make around $44,778. That is a strong return on a $24,499 median debt. The acceptance rate is 94%.
Saint Cloud State University landed the #10 spot for educational, instructional, & curriculum supervision value this year. Saint Cloud State University is a large public school located in the city of Saint Cloud. In-state tuition and fees average $10,245. Typical student debt for educational, instructional, & curriculum supervision graduates is $25,076. Early-career educational, instructional, & curriculum supervision graduates make about $50,052. Set against $25,076 in median debt, that is a healthy payoff. Roughly 95% of applicants are accepted.
Suny College At Buffalo landed the #21 spot for educational, instructional, & curriculum supervision value this year. Located in the city of Buffalo, Suny College At Buffalo is a moderately-sized public university. The average in-state cost of tuition and fees is $8,533, with out-of-state students paying around $19,653. Students borrow a median of $25,257 to complete the educational, instructional, & curriculum supervision program here. Educational, Instructional, & Curriculum Supervision graduates of Suny College At Buffalo earn a median of $39,412 early in their careers. That is a strong return on a $25,257 median debt. Roughly 73% of applicants are accepted.
University Of Arizona landed the #22 spot for educational, instructional, & curriculum supervision value this year. Set in the city of Tucson, University Of Arizona is a very large public institution. The average in-state cost of tuition and fees is $13,573, while out-of-state students pay about $39,903. Educational, Instructional, & Curriculum Supervision graduates carry a median of $21,861 in student loans. Educational, Instructional, & Curriculum Supervision graduates of University Of Arizona earn a median of $51,878 early in their careers. Set against $21,861 in median debt, that is a healthy payoff. Roughly 86% of applicants are accepted.
National Louis University came in at #23 for value in educational, instructional, & curriculum supervision this year. Set in the city of Chicago, National Louis University is a large private not-for-profit institution. The average in-state cost of tuition and fees is $13,245. Students borrow a median of $29,242 to complete the educational, instructional, & curriculum supervision program here. Early-career educational, instructional, & curriculum supervision graduates make about $73,738. Weighed against typical debt, the earnings make a compelling case for value. National Louis University admits about 95% of applicants.
Wright State University Main Campus landed the #24 spot for educational, instructional, & curriculum supervision value this year. Wright State University Main Campus is a large public school located in the suburb of Dayton. The average in-state cost of tuition and fees is $10,991, while out-of-state students pay about $20,691. Educational, Instructional, & Curriculum Supervision graduates carry a median of $25,836 in student loans. Soon after graduation, educational, instructional, & curriculum supervision degree recipients from Wright State University Main Campus generally make around $49,077. That is a strong return on a $25,836 median debt. The acceptance rate is 96%.
Central Michigan University ranked #25 on our 2026 list of the best value educational, instructional, & curriculum supervision schools. Located in the town of Mount Pleasant, Central Michigan University is a large public university. In-state tuition and fees average $15,480. Students borrow a median of $27,857 to complete the educational, instructional, & curriculum supervision program here. Soon after graduation, educational, instructional, & curriculum supervision degree recipients from Central Michigan University generally make around $50,688. Weighed against typical debt, the earnings make a compelling case for value. The acceptance rate is 90%.
